Contents
The following modules are indicative of what you will study on this course. For more details on course structure and modules, and how you will be taught and assessed, see the full course document on the Master website.
Core modules, semester one:
- Fashion business and Supply Chain Management
- Creative Team Building
- Strategic Fashion Business Management
Core modules, semester two:
- Finance and Entrepreneurship
- Fashion Marketing and Brand Management
- Managing Change and Innovation
- Major Fashion Business Management Project
Requirements
Entry to the course is based on a combination of formal qualifications and significant industry experience. You should have a First or Upper Second in your first degree in any subject, as well as a minimum of two years' working experience in the fashion industry after graduation, although three years' experience is preferred.
